VIDEO: Protesters Block Parliament Entrances in Jerusalem to Prevent Voting
In Jerusalem, protesters have blocked all access roads to the parliamentary building to prevent voting on judicial reforms. The Israeli police have deployed water cannons to disperse the demonstrators.
It is noteworthy that mass protests have resumed in various regions of Israel. The protesters are expressing their opposition to the policy of the government led by Benjamin Netanyahu and its proposed reform plan, which aims to limit the Supreme Court's powers and grant the executive branch the authority to oversee the selection of judges.
The initiative, presented by the cabinet at the beginning of the year, sparked intense backlash from the opposition, which argues that the reform, in its current form, would undermine the foundations of democracy. Protests have been ongoing for 29 weeks.
